Anomalous electronic conductance in quasicrystals
Abstract
Generic quantum interference effects occuring in 1D-quasicrystals are reviewed with emphasis on the joint effect of phason disorder on electronic localization and propagation modes. In close conjunction with properties of real materials, the contributions of quantum interferences in several regimes close to the metal insulator transition are outlined.
